Connecting to DeviceNet
You can connect a MicroLogix 1500 using DF1 Full-Duplex protocol to a DeviceNet network using the DeviceNet Interface (DNI), catalog number 1761-NET-DNI. For additional information on using the DNI, refer to the DeviceNet Interface User Manual, publication 1761-6.5.
